Bryan LaFlam Secures Ownership Stake in BigStuff Total Power Management

LaFlam will work alongside Ben Davidow, who acquired the company in 2021, as co-owner and director of operations.

Bryan LaFlam, a business development specialist and Top Sportsman racer, has acquired an ownership stake in BigStuff Total Power Management, a Newark, CA-based provider of electronic engine and powertrain controllers.

Bryan will be responsible for enhancing the overall business, optimizing operations, streamlining manufacturing and strengthening the company’s supply chain, the company said, while Davidow will continue to focus on product development and enhancing technical support.
